Tracker Season 3 Removes Bobby and Velma Characters

In the latest season of CBS’s hit series *Tracker*, two key characters, Bobby and Velma, have been officially written out. The third season premiered on October 19, 2024, marking significant changes in the show’s ensemble cast.

Character Exits and Transition

During the season premiere, Reenie, portrayed by Fiona Rene, mentioned Velma’s absence, stating she was with her wife, Teddi, attempting to mend their marriage. Meanwhile, Randy, played by Chris Lee, shared a text from Bobby, played by Eric Graise, who has transitioned to a new job as an encryption specialist at a startup.

  • Velma’s character is officially off the show, focusing on her relationship with Teddi.
  • Bobby has left his previous role at the repair shop for a new opportunity.

Viewer Reactions and Future Developments

Viewers have expressed concern over the loss of these familiar faces. Bobby, who had been absent from multiple episodes in the previous season, was appreciated for his presence, highlighting the emotional investment fans have in the characters.

Executive producer Elwood Reid defended the shakeup, insisting it allows for character evolution. He emphasized the necessity of developing engaging storylines without falling into a repetitive formula. Reid noted that the direction for season three aims to delve deeper into the remaining characters, such as Reenie and Randy.

Continuing Success of *Tracker*

*Tracker* has been a solid performer for CBS since its February 2024 premiere, garnering record-breaking ratings. The series follows survivalist Colter Shaw, played by Justin Hartley, as he travels across the country to solve missing persons cases and investigate criminal activities.

The shakeups in the cast, however, have raised questions about the show’s future trajectory. But Reid remains optimistic, highlighting the ongoing development of existing characters and introducing new ones in upcoming episodes.
